About Ilminster Avenue Nursery School
Ilminster Avenue Nursery School, a state nursery for children aged 2 to 4 in Bristol, holds a Good Ofsted rating, which places it in the majority of the city's nursery provision. Of the twelve nursery schools in the local authority, only three have achieved the top Outstanding grade, so Ilminster Avenue sits within the solid middle tier. The school's most recent ungraded inspection in November 2024 confirmed that standards are being maintained, following a full graded inspection in 2019 that also rated it Good overall, with Good marks for both leadership and management and overall effectiveness. This consistency is a reassuring signal for parents, particularly given that the school serves a community with a high proportion of disadvantaged pupils — 37.3 per cent of children are eligible for free school meals, well above the national average for nursery settings.
Academic outcomes are not published for nursery schools in the same way they are for primary or secondary phases, so there are no Progress 8 scores or KS2 SATs results to compare against the local authority average. Instead, the most useful measure of how well the school is doing comes from its parent view survey, which ran between September 2024 and September 2025 and received 22 responses. The results are overwhelmingly positive: 95 per cent of parents would recommend the school, and 100 per cent agreed or strongly agreed that their child is happy and feels safe. On communication, 95 per cent of parents felt the school makes them aware of what their child will learn, and 91 per cent agreed that the school lets them know how their child is doing. The only area where a small minority expressed dissatisfaction was around the range of clubs and activities, with 9 per cent disagreeing that their child can take part.
